Author: Christina Baker Kline
This is a piece of Christina Olson’s world. The breathtaking coming-of-age story of a young woman born and bred on a farm on the rocky shore of Maine. A woman who would go on to inspire Andrew Wyeth’s most haunting and unforgettable painting, Christina’s World. — From the age of three the hard existence of farm life on Hathorn P...  more »

A wonderful, heartwarming read. The characters in this book are based on actual characters and there experiences during a lifetime. The main character, Christina Olson is a strong determined soul, working to get through day to day, fighting to care for her family and maintain her dignity.
Meeting obstacles, that would stump others, she fights to protect her family and her property.
Although a work of fiction and fact entwined the author has incorporated elements of both to bring life to this novel.
Once you start reading it, you will have a difficult time putting itdown.
